Today marks the 75th anniversary of the International Day of United Nations Peacekeepers, a day dedicated to honouring the courageous men and women who have served and continue to serve in UN peacekeeping missions.

These individuals are recognised for their exceptional professionalism, unwavering dedication, and selfless commitment to maintaining peace worldwide.

President Hage Geingob acknowledges the significant role played by UN peacekeeping personnel in safeguarding the peace that Namibia currently enjoys.

President Hage Geingob says universal health coverage remains a priority for Namibia as the country joins the rest of the world in commemorating the 75th anniversary of the World Health Organization.

Dr. Geingob said in a statement that the priority is to ensure that every Namibian has access to health care where and when they need it, without the financial burden that may limit access.

Over the past 75 years, the world has witnessed advancements in public health worth celebrating.
